Subject: On-call intro — PickPath optimizer

Hi, and welcome to the rotation. PickPath generates optimized pick lists for the Hollow Creek warehouse every fifteen minutes. Most pages you'll get are route-solver timeouts; the fix is usually restarting the solver pod and replaying the last batch. Anything involving inventory mismatches goes to the Stockline team instead. The full triage guide is on the internal page below.

operations page: https://jenkins.zemvarcloud.local/job/merge_requests/repo/build/73930b4b30f0a8ed

Welcome aboard! Our docs site runs through the Fernpress markdown pipeline: authors commit .md files, a preprocessor expands our custom callout syntax, then Fernpress renders to HTML and pushes to the CDN. Don't edit generated HTML directly — it gets clobbered nightly. The full pipeline diagram and local setup steps live here.

wiki page, tagep-baweg: https://jira.lumicsys.internal/display/display/browse/display

Factories are seeded per suite, so identical seeds yield identical datasets — never commit tests that depend on random output. To add a new factory, register it in the catalog module and regenerate the schema snapshot; CI rejects unregistered factories. If a suite fails with a schema-drift error, regenerate snapshots locally and re-push rather than editing them by hand. When reporting factory issues, always include the generating build, identified by the token below.

trace token, fafog-kageg: htk4_98e6

The Restockr vending-machine planner double-counts inventory for machines with paired spiral slots, inflating projected stock and skipping needed restocks. Root cause: the slot-merge routine treats paired spirals as independent lanes when the planogram lacks a pairing flag. Fix adds a fallback that infers pairing from matching product codes. Future maintainers: any change to slot-merge must rerun the planogram fixture suite, as edge cases are subtle. The fix shipped in the nightly identified by the token below.

session token of hawif-bajog = htk6_9ab8da